Quantifying Audience Resonance

Implement semantic evaluation on player forum dialogues. Track the frequency and context of specific terminology associated with user experience. For instance, a recurring mention of „payout velocity“ or „assistance responsiveness“ in a positive frame directly signals operational superiority. Tools like lexical affinity modeling can isolate these patterns from background noise.

Competitive Linguistic Auditing

Perform a comparative assessment of descriptive language across multiple operators. The establishment Tsars Casino de might be associated with specific, recurring adjectives in community discussions. Mapping this lexicon against rivals reveals unique perceived attributes. This isn’t about volume, but about the consistency of specific qualitative terms.

Algorithmic Reputation Tracking

Deploy a scraper to collect and categorize public commentary from social media and review aggregators. Use a Naive Bayes classifier to automatically sort statements into categories: transactional efficiency, game variety, promotional value. A sustained positive trend in „transactional efficiency“ over a 90-day period correlates strongly with customer retention rates.

Actionable Data Points

Move beyond basic metrics. Focus on these three analytical actions:

  1. Calculate Emotion Score: Use natural language processing libraries (e.g., VADER) to assign an emotional weight to user-generated content. Aggregate scores weekly.
  2. Identify Unique Value Propositions: Through cluster analysis of review texts, determine which features are exclusively highlighted for your property versus the wider market.
  3. Pinpoint Crisis Indicators: Set alerts for a sudden 15% increase in negative sentiment mentions related to a specific service aspect, enabling immediate operational review.

This method transforms subjective commentary into a structured performance dashboard. The objective is to convert language into a leading indicator for strategic decisions, not merely a retrospective report.

How exactly does text analysis measure the strength of a brand like Tsars Casino online?

Text analysis software scans vast amounts of online text from sources like review sites, forums, social media, and news articles. For a casino brand, it looks for specific indicators. First, it measures visibility: how often the brand name is mentioned compared to competitors. Second, it assesses sentiment: whether the words used around „Tsars Casino“ are positive (e.g., „fast payout,“ „great slots“), negative (e.g., „slow verification,“ „unfair terms“), or neutral. Third, it examines associated keywords to understand brand perception—are people linking it to „luxury“ and „exclusive“ or to „bonus issues“ and „complaints“? By tracking these metrics over time, analysts can see if brand strength is improving or declining based on real public conversation, not just internal company data.

What are the biggest challenges in getting accurate text analysis for an online casino brand?

Several significant challenges exist. The online gambling sector has specific slang and jargon, so analysis tools must be trained to understand terms like „RTP,“ „wagering requirements,“ or „no-deposit bonus“ in context. A major issue is sarcasm and irony, which are common in player forums; a comment like „What a generous bonus!“ might be negative if the requirements are seen as unfair. Another challenge is separating genuine player sentiment from promotional content, affiliate marketing posts, or fake reviews. Furthermore, regulatory discussions often mix the brand name with negative legal or ethical discourse, which can skew sentiment scores without reflecting actual customer experience. Accurate analysis requires constant refinement of the software’s linguistic models to account for these industry-specific nuances.

Can you give a concrete example of how Tsars Casino might use these text analysis findings?

If analysis reveals a frequent negative link between „Tsars Casino“ and „withdrawal time“ across multiple forums, the customer service team can be alerted. Management might then review and streamline the cashout process. Conversely, if data shows strong positive association with a specific game provider like „NetEnt,“ the marketing department could create targeted campaigns highlighting those games. The analysis also helps monitor campaign launch impact. After introducing a new live dealer section, a spike in mentions with words like „realistic,“ „professional,“ and „immersive“ would signal a successful reception. This allows for data-driven decisions, shifting resources to what customers genuinely appreciate and addressing pain points directly.
